數(shù)字電路課程設(shè)計(jì)九路搶答器_第1頁(yè)
數(shù)字電路課程設(shè)計(jì)九路搶答器_第2頁(yè)
數(shù)字電路課程設(shè)計(jì)九路搶答器_第3頁(yè)
數(shù)字電路課程設(shè)計(jì)九路搶答器_第4頁(yè)
數(shù)字電路課程設(shè)計(jì)九路搶答器_第5頁(yè)
已閱讀5頁(yè),還剩37頁(yè)未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

數(shù)字電路課程設(shè)計(jì)九路搶答器2024-01-09目錄課程設(shè)計(jì)背景與目的九路搶答器原理及功能硬件設(shè)計(jì)與實(shí)現(xiàn)軟件編程與調(diào)試系統(tǒng)測(cè)試與性能分析課程設(shè)計(jì)總結(jié)與展望01課程設(shè)計(jì)背景與目的隨著科技的進(jìn)步,數(shù)字電路在各個(gè)領(lǐng)域的應(yīng)用越來(lái)越廣泛,掌握數(shù)字電路設(shè)計(jì)和分析的能力對(duì)于電子類專業(yè)學(xué)生至關(guān)重要。搶答器在各種競(jìng)賽、活動(dòng)中有著廣泛的應(yīng)用,能夠快速、準(zhǔn)確地判斷參賽者的搶答行為,保證比賽的公平性和公正性。背景介紹搶答器應(yīng)用場(chǎng)景數(shù)字化時(shí)代的需求提高實(shí)踐動(dòng)手能力通過(guò)實(shí)際操作和調(diào)試,提高學(xué)生的實(shí)踐動(dòng)手能力和解決問(wèn)題的能力。培養(yǎng)創(chuàng)新意識(shí)鼓勵(lì)學(xué)生發(fā)揮想象力和創(chuàng)造力,設(shè)計(jì)出具有創(chuàng)新性的搶答器方案。掌握數(shù)字電路設(shè)計(jì)原理通過(guò)設(shè)計(jì)九路搶答器,使學(xué)生深入理解和掌握數(shù)字電路的基本原理和設(shè)計(jì)方法。設(shè)計(jì)目的03性能穩(wěn)定可靠經(jīng)過(guò)測(cè)試和調(diào)試,搶答器的性能穩(wěn)定可靠,能夠滿足實(shí)際應(yīng)用的需求。01完成九路搶答器設(shè)計(jì)學(xué)生能夠獨(dú)立完成九路搶答器的設(shè)計(jì),包括電路原理圖、PCB板圖等。02實(shí)現(xiàn)基本功能搶答器能夠?qū)崿F(xiàn)基本的搶答功能,包括搶答信號(hào)的輸入、處理和輸出等。預(yù)期成果02九路搶答器原理及功能優(yōu)先編碼原理九路搶答器采用優(yōu)先編碼器對(duì)輸入的九個(gè)信號(hào)進(jìn)行編碼,當(dāng)有多個(gè)信號(hào)同時(shí)輸入時(shí),優(yōu)先編碼器會(huì)優(yōu)先響應(yīng)優(yōu)先級(jí)最高的信號(hào)。鎖存原理當(dāng)某個(gè)參賽者按下?lián)尨鸢粹o時(shí),鎖存器會(huì)鎖存該信號(hào),確保其他參賽者無(wú)法再次搶答,直到主持人清零。搶答器工作原理?yè)尨鸸δ苣軌蚪邮站艂€(gè)參賽者的搶答信號(hào),并準(zhǔn)確判斷第一個(gè)按下按鈕的參賽者。顯示功能通過(guò)數(shù)碼管或LED燈顯示搶答成功的參賽者編號(hào)。鎖存功能確保搶答成功后,其他參賽者無(wú)法再次搶答。清零功能主持人可操作清零開(kāi)關(guān),將搶答器清零,以便進(jìn)行下一輪搶答。功能需求分析ABCD關(guān)鍵技術(shù)點(diǎn)優(yōu)先編碼技術(shù)采用高性能優(yōu)先編碼器,實(shí)現(xiàn)對(duì)九個(gè)輸入信號(hào)的快速、準(zhǔn)確響應(yīng)。顯示技術(shù)通過(guò)數(shù)碼管或LED燈動(dòng)態(tài)顯示搶答成功的參賽者編號(hào),提供直觀、明了的視覺(jué)效果。鎖存技術(shù)利用鎖存器對(duì)搶答信號(hào)進(jìn)行鎖存,防止其他參賽者在搶答成功后再次搶答。清零技術(shù)設(shè)計(jì)清零電路,實(shí)現(xiàn)主持人對(duì)搶答器的清零操作,確保每輪搶答的公正性。03硬件設(shè)計(jì)與實(shí)現(xiàn)主要器件選擇與參數(shù)微控制器選用高性能、低功耗的8051系列微控制器,具有足夠的I/O端口和定時(shí)器資源,滿足搶答器的實(shí)時(shí)性和穩(wěn)定性要求。顯示模塊選用LED數(shù)碼管顯示模塊,可實(shí)時(shí)顯示搶答結(jié)果和倒計(jì)時(shí)時(shí)間。數(shù)碼管具有高亮度、長(zhǎng)壽命、低功耗等優(yōu)點(diǎn),適用于搶答器應(yīng)用場(chǎng)景。按鍵輸入模塊采用矩陣鍵盤輸入方式,實(shí)現(xiàn)9路搶答輸入。按鍵采用機(jī)械觸點(diǎn)式按鍵,具有明確的觸感和較長(zhǎng)的使用壽命。聲音提示模塊采用蜂鳴器作為聲音提示器件,實(shí)現(xiàn)不同狀態(tài)下的聲音提示功能,如搶答成功、倒計(jì)時(shí)結(jié)束等。0102電源電路采用穩(wěn)定的5V直流電源供電,保證搶答器的正常工作。電源電路包括整流、濾波、穩(wěn)壓等部分,確保輸出電壓的穩(wěn)定性和紋波系數(shù)滿足要求。微控制器電路微控制器是整個(gè)搶答器的核心部分,負(fù)責(zé)與按鍵輸入模塊、顯示模塊、聲音提示模塊等進(jìn)行通信和控制。微控制器電路包括晶振電路、復(fù)位電路、I/O端口擴(kuò)展等部分。按鍵輸入電路按鍵輸入電路采用矩陣鍵盤掃描方式,將9個(gè)按鍵的輸入信號(hào)轉(zhuǎn)換為微控制器可識(shí)別的數(shù)字信號(hào)。按鍵輸入電路具有去抖動(dòng)功能,確保按鍵輸入的準(zhǔn)確性和穩(wěn)定性。顯示電路顯示電路采用共陽(yáng)極數(shù)碼管顯示方式,通過(guò)微控制器的I/O端口控制數(shù)碼管的顯示內(nèi)容。顯示電路具有亮度調(diào)節(jié)功能,可根據(jù)環(huán)境光線自動(dòng)調(diào)節(jié)數(shù)碼管的亮度。聲音提示電路聲音提示電路通過(guò)微控制器的I/O端口控制蜂鳴器的發(fā)聲,實(shí)現(xiàn)不同狀態(tài)下的聲音提示功能。聲音提示電路具有音量調(diào)節(jié)功能,可根據(jù)實(shí)際需求調(diào)節(jié)蜂鳴器的音量大小。030405電路設(shè)計(jì)圖及說(shuō)明PCB布局與布線根據(jù)電路設(shè)計(jì)圖進(jìn)行PCB布局設(shè)計(jì),合理安排元器件的位置和間距,確保PCB板的機(jī)械強(qiáng)度和電氣性能滿足要求。同時(shí)考慮散熱和抗干擾等因素,對(duì)關(guān)鍵元器件進(jìn)行特殊處理。PCB布局布線設(shè)計(jì)遵循“最短距離、最小環(huán)路、最大間距”的原則,盡量減少信號(hào)傳輸延遲和干擾。對(duì)于高速信號(hào)線和敏感信號(hào)線采用差分對(duì)走線方式,降低信號(hào)間的串?dāng)_和輻射干擾。同時(shí)設(shè)置合理的接地層和電源層,提高PCB板的抗干擾能力和穩(wěn)定性。布線設(shè)計(jì)04軟件編程與調(diào)試編程語(yǔ)言選擇C語(yǔ)言,因其具有高效、靈活、可移植性強(qiáng)等特點(diǎn),適合用于嵌入式系統(tǒng)的開(kāi)發(fā)。開(kāi)發(fā)環(huán)境搭建使用KeilC51作為集成開(kāi)發(fā)環(huán)境(IDE),它支持C語(yǔ)言的編寫(xiě)、編譯、調(diào)試等功能,并提供了豐富的庫(kù)函數(shù)和中間件,方便開(kāi)發(fā)者進(jìn)行嵌入式系統(tǒng)的開(kāi)發(fā)。編程語(yǔ)言選擇及環(huán)境搭建主程序流程圖主程序流程圖及說(shuō)明```初始化開(kāi)始主程序流程圖及說(shuō)明03是01等待按鍵輸入02判斷按鍵輸入主程序流程圖及說(shuō)明123顯示按鍵號(hào)碼播放提示音等待復(fù)位信號(hào)主程序流程圖及說(shuō)明否繼續(xù)等待按鍵輸入結(jié)束主程序流程圖及說(shuō)明```說(shuō)明:主程序首先進(jìn)行初始化操作,包括設(shè)置IO口、定時(shí)器、中斷等。然后進(jìn)入等待按鍵輸入狀態(tài),一旦有按鍵輸入,程序會(huì)判斷是哪個(gè)按鍵被按下,并顯示相應(yīng)的按鍵號(hào)碼,同時(shí)播放提示音。最后等待復(fù)位信號(hào),如果沒(méi)有復(fù)位信號(hào)則繼續(xù)等待按鍵輸入。主程序流程圖及說(shuō)明初始化代碼段關(guān)鍵代碼段展示01```c02voidInit(){03//設(shè)置IO口為輸入模式關(guān)鍵代碼段展示P1=0xFF;//P1口全部設(shè)置為高電平,即輸入模式關(guān)鍵代碼段展示關(guān)鍵代碼段展示//設(shè)置定時(shí)器TMOD=0x01;//設(shè)置定時(shí)器0為模式1(16位定時(shí)/計(jì)數(shù)器)TH0=(65536-50000)/256;//設(shè)置定時(shí)器0初值,定時(shí)50msTL0=(65536-50000)%256;ET0=1;//開(kāi)啟定時(shí)器0中斷EA=1;//開(kāi)啟總中斷關(guān)鍵代碼段展示TR0=1;//啟動(dòng)定時(shí)器0關(guān)鍵代碼段展示關(guān)鍵代碼段展示010203```按鍵處理代碼段}關(guān)鍵代碼段展示01```c02voidKeyProcess(){if(P1!=0xFF){//如果有按鍵按下03if(P1!=0xFF){//再次判斷按鍵是否按下key_value=P1;//獲取按鍵值delay(10);//延時(shí)消抖關(guān)鍵代碼段展示010203display(key_value);//顯示按鍵號(hào)碼play_sound();//播放提示音while(P1!=0xFF);//等待按鍵釋放關(guān)鍵代碼段展示02030401關(guān)鍵代碼段展示}}}```05系統(tǒng)測(cè)試與性能分析驗(yàn)證九路搶答器的功能正確性和性能穩(wěn)定性。測(cè)試目的測(cè)試環(huán)境測(cè)試方法搭建符合九路搶答器工作要求的測(cè)試環(huán)境,包括電源、輸入信號(hào)源、負(fù)載等。采用黑盒測(cè)試和白盒測(cè)試相結(jié)合的方法,對(duì)九路搶答器的各項(xiàng)功能進(jìn)行全面測(cè)試。030201測(cè)試方案制定詳細(xì)記錄測(cè)試過(guò)程中的輸入信號(hào)、輸出信號(hào)、中間狀態(tài)等關(guān)鍵數(shù)據(jù)。測(cè)試數(shù)據(jù)記錄對(duì)測(cè)試數(shù)據(jù)進(jìn)行統(tǒng)計(jì)、分析和比較,得出九路搶答器的性能指標(biāo)和存在的問(wèn)題。數(shù)據(jù)處理與分析對(duì)測(cè)試中發(fā)現(xiàn)的問(wèn)題進(jìn)行跟蹤,分析問(wèn)題原因并提出解決方案,確保問(wèn)題得到及時(shí)解決。問(wèn)題跟蹤與解決測(cè)試數(shù)據(jù)記錄與處理評(píng)估九路搶答器的響應(yīng)時(shí)間是否符合設(shè)計(jì)要求,并分析影響響應(yīng)時(shí)間的因素。響應(yīng)時(shí)間評(píng)估準(zhǔn)確性評(píng)估穩(wěn)定性評(píng)估可靠性評(píng)估評(píng)估九路搶答器在各種條件下的準(zhǔn)確性,包括不同輸入信號(hào)幅度、頻率和負(fù)載條件下的準(zhǔn)確性。評(píng)估九路搶答器在長(zhǎng)時(shí)間工作和不同環(huán)境溫度下的穩(wěn)定性,并分析影響穩(wěn)定性的因素。評(píng)估九路搶答器的可靠性,包括平均無(wú)故障時(shí)間、故障率等指標(biāo),并分析影響可靠性的因素。性能指標(biāo)評(píng)估06課程設(shè)計(jì)總結(jié)與展望實(shí)現(xiàn)九路搶答功能成功設(shè)計(jì)并實(shí)現(xiàn)了一個(gè)九路搶答器,能夠準(zhǔn)確、快速地識(shí)別并顯示第一個(gè)搶答者的編號(hào)。顯示模塊設(shè)計(jì)采用LED數(shù)碼管作為顯示模塊,直觀展示搶答結(jié)果,方便觀眾和裁判查看。穩(wěn)定性與可靠性經(jīng)過(guò)多次測(cè)試,系統(tǒng)表現(xiàn)穩(wěn)定,未出現(xiàn)誤判或漏判情況,確保了比賽的公正性。設(shè)計(jì)成果總結(jié)在課程設(shè)計(jì)過(guò)程中,我們深刻體會(huì)到團(tuán)隊(duì)協(xié)作的重要性。只有每個(gè)成員都積極參與、充分溝通,才能確保項(xiàng)目的順利進(jìn)行。團(tuán)隊(duì)協(xié)作重要性由于課程設(shè)計(jì)時(shí)間有限,我們學(xué)會(huì)了如何合理安排時(shí)間,確保項(xiàng)目按時(shí)完成。同時(shí),也意識(shí)到在項(xiàng)目初期制定詳細(xì)計(jì)劃的重要性。時(shí)間管理通過(guò)本次課程設(shè)計(jì),我們更加明白理論與實(shí)踐相結(jié)合的重要性。只有將理論知識(shí)應(yīng)用到實(shí)際中,才能真正掌握并靈活運(yùn)用所學(xué)知識(shí)。理論與實(shí)

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論